Background: Perinatal depression is a major global public health problem, but the onset and progression of symptoms that give rise to perinatal depression are less clear in the scientific literature.
Methods: This study followed 1210 Chinese pregnant women who completed the Edinburgh Postnatal Depression Scale at five time points: 13, 24, and 37 weeks of gestation (G13, G24, G37), and 1 and 6 weeks postpartum (W1, W6). Cross-lagged panel networks were used to analyze and compare networks from first to second trimester (G13 → G24), second to third trimester (G24 → G37), and one week to six weeks postpartum (W1 → W6).

View Article and Find Full Text PDFPurpose Of Review: This review focuses on the viral and immune factors influencing HIV posttreatment control (PTC), a rare condition where individuals maintain viral suppression after discontinuing antiretroviral therapy (ART).
Recent Findings: Studies demonstrate that early ART initiation leads to smaller HIV reservoirs and delayed viral rebound in PTCs. Virologically, PTCs harbor smaller HIV reservoirs and show lower levels of reservoir transcriptional activity compared with posttreatment noncontrollers.
This study aimed to investigate the effect of the deacetylated konjac glucomannan (DKGM), with varying degree of deacetylation (DD), on the physicochemical and structural properties of transglutaminase-induced soy protein isolate (SPI) cold-set gels. Compared with native konjac glucomannan (KGM), DKGM significantly enhanced the gel strength, water-holding capacity, and thermal stability of the composite gels, with DK3 (DKGM with 65.85 % deacetylation) showing the most significant improvement.

View Article and Find Full Text PDFObjectives: China has experienced a notable upsurge in pertussis cases post-COVID-19, alongside an age shift to older children, increased vaccine escape, and a notable rise in the prevalence of macrolide-resistant Bordetella pertussis. Here, we present a genomic epidemiological investigation of these events.
Methods: We performed a retrospective observational study using culture-positive B pertussis isolated in Shanghai, China, from 2016 to 2024.
